    The New York Liberty and the Atlanta Dream will meet at the Barclays Center on Tuesday night for another game in the WNBA 2024 postseason. The New York Liberty finished their regular season at the top of the Eastern Conference with an impressive 32-8 record. On the other hand, the Atlanta Dream are fourth and finished 15-25 on the season. According to the best bets for this playoff series, the New York Liberty will win against Atlanta.

    New York Liberty

    The New York Liberty managed to win impressively against the Atlanta Dream in Round 1 with a final score of 83-69. In that game, New York’s Leonie Fiebich scored a remarkable 21 points, along with a single rebound and assist, while Breanna Stewart managed 20 points, along with 11 boards and a trio of helpers. On offense, the Liberty are scoring 85.68 points in each game, while allowing 76.88 points per contest.

    Top 3 Players

    Leonie Fiebich: PTS 6.7 REB 3.0 AST 1.8 STL 1.0

    Breanna Stewart: PTS 20.4 REB 8.5 AST 3.5 STL 1.7

    Sabrina Ionescu: PTS 18.2 REB 4.4 AST 6.2 STL 1.0

     

    Atlanta Dream

    The Atlanta Dream lost the first round against the Liberty in the playoffs, as their offense crumbled. Against the Liberty, Atlanta’s Rhyne Howard scored a total of 14 points, along with six boards and four helpers for the team. Tina Charles contributed to the score with 12 points along with seven rebounds. The Dream are scoring an average of 77.00 points in each contest, while allowing their opponents to get away with 79.75 points per game.

    Top 3 Players

    Rhyne Howard: PTS 17.3 REB 4.4 AST 3.1 STL 1.8

    Tina Charles: PTS 14.9 REB 9.6 AST 2.3 STL 0.9

    Allisha Gray: PTS 15.6 REB 4.4 AST 2.7 STL 1.1
